How to Make Boomette's Drink

  1. Fill a cocktail shaker with ice.
  2. Add 2 oz Vodka, 1 oz Fresh Lime Juice, 0.75 oz Cointreau (or other orange liqueur), 0.5 oz Simple Syrup, and 2-3 raspberries.
  3. Secure the shaker lid tightly and shake vigorously for 15-20 seconds until well-chilled.
  4. Double strain into two chilled cocktail glasses or one large hurricane glass.
  5. Garnish with a lime wheel, orange slice, or your favorite fruit (fresh raspberries are particularly delicious!).
